Clipboard实现文件,文本的"复制","粘贴"
2008-07-02 10:32
671 查看
C#可以利用Clipboard实现文件,文本的"复制","粘贴"同时也可以实现"剪切"(此功能是先复制再删除);
再 Windows mobile 5.0 平台中,Clipboard实现的功能比较有限,它只可以实现文本和图象的复制和粘贴(个人见解)
以下是我的一段代码;功能是实现复制,粘贴文本文件; (把剪切板中的数据 加载到textbox中)
IDataObject pasteData = Clipboard.GetDataObject();//声明一个IDataObject 对象以存储从Clipboard中获得的数据,如果剪贴板中没有数据,则为 空引用.
if (pasteData.GetDataPresent(DataFormats.Text))//判断剪切板中的数据是否是你需要的类型
txt_value.Text = pasteData.GetData(DataFormats.Text).ToString();
再 Windows mobile 5.0 平台中,Clipboard实现的功能比较有限,它只可以实现文本和图象的复制和粘贴(个人见解)
以下是我的一段代码;功能是实现复制,粘贴文本文件; (把剪切板中的数据 加载到textbox中)
IDataObject pasteData = Clipboard.GetDataObject();//声明一个IDataObject 对象以存储从Clipboard中获得的数据,如果剪贴板中没有数据,则为 空引用.
if (pasteData.GetDataPresent(DataFormats.Text))//判断剪切板中的数据是否是你需要的类型
txt_value.Text = pasteData.GetData(DataFormats.Text).ToString();
相关文章推荐
- "打开,保存"文件框的文本溢出排查
- "用ASP实现" 自动解压RAR文件的功能
- UNIX环境高级编程学习之第四章文件和目录-用C实现Shell中的"ls -l"功能
- 使用<input type="file">实现文件上传
- asp.net/c# 用<input type="file" />实现文件上传,multipart/form-data
- 用C实现C++的多态---剖析GTK的"对象" (四)
- 使用fsck命令修复linux文件系统错误【避开引起系统崩溃,启动不了的"-a"选项】
- "SQLServer复制需要有实际的服务器名称才能连接到服务器,请指定实际的服务器名"
- vi & vim复制,粘贴,剪切文本
- 如何实现虚拟机与主机之间的文件共享、复制粘贴
- Net Remoting 实现简易的"命令行控制台"聊天室 选择自 playyuer 的 Blog
- "只有在配置文件或 page 指令中将 enablesessionstate 设置为 true 时"错误解决方案
- 如何把虚拟机上的文本或是文件复制粘贴到本地?
- 使用"JSONKit.h"解析文件
- 如何使 FlashGet "正常合法" 下载 Session 中的自定义文件链接呢? JSP/Servlet 实现!
- Java实现简单文本文件复制
- JS 实现网页中的"运行代码"功能
- <input type="text"> and <html:text> 禁止复制
- 用clipboard.js实现纯JS复制文本到剪切板
- "忘记密码"功能过程及其实现细节